Responsibilities
Person who intervenes with individuals, families, groups, or communities facing various social issues to help them meet their needs, promote the defense of their rights, and foster social change.

- Must hold a Diploma of College Studies (DEC) with specialization in social services techniques or social assistance techniques from a school recognized by the Ministry of Education, Recreation and Sports
- A valid driver's license and English proficiency may be required for certain programs.
- NB :
- Any degree obtained abroad must have undergone a Comparative Evaluation of Studies Completed Outside Quebec by the Ministry of Immigration, Francization and Integration. Please include the evaluation result in your CV, otherwise your application may not be considered.
- Any college diploma obtained outside Quebec must have undergone a Recognition of Prior Learning (RPL) by a recognized Quebec school. Please include the RPL in your CV, otherwise your application may not be considered.
